    Chickie's and Pete's

    No list of Philly sports bars would be complete without Chickie's and Pete's. This place is legendary, and for good reason. With multiple locations throughout the Philadelphia area, you're never too far from their famous Crabfries and a cold beer. During Eagles games, the atmosphere is absolutely electric. Walls plastered with TVs ensure you won't miss a single play, and the roar of the crowd after a touchdown is deafening. Chickie's and Pete's is more than just a sports bar; it's a Philadelphia institution.

    The key to Chickie's and Pete's success is their commitment to creating a high-energy, fan-focused environment. They often host pre-game and post-game parties, and their staff is always decked out in Eagles gear. The menu is extensive, with something for everyone, but let's be honest, you're really there for the Crabfries. These crispy, seasoned fries served with a creamy white cheese sauce are a Philly staple, and they're the perfect accompaniment to an Eagles victory. The bar areas are spacious and well-designed, ensuring a good view of the game from virtually every seat. While it can get crowded, especially during peak game times, that's part of the experience. You're surrounded by fellow fans, all united in their love for the Eagles. Chickie's and Pete's isn't just a place to watch the game; it's a place to celebrate the Eagles spirit.

    Xfinity Live!

    Located in the heart of the stadium district, Xfinity Live! is a massive entertainment complex that's always buzzing on game days. With multiple bars and restaurants under one roof, you can find the perfect vibe to match your mood. Whether you're looking for a lively party atmosphere or a more relaxed setting, Xfinity Live! has something for everyone. Plus, with giant screens and state-of-the-art sound systems, you'll feel like you're right in the middle of the action. Xfinity Live offers an immersive experience, with multiple venues each offering its own unique take on game-day festivities. From Victory Beer Hall to NBC Sports Arena, you can explore different atmospheres and find the perfect spot to cheer on the Eagles.

    One of the biggest draws of Xfinity Live! is its sheer size and variety. You can start the day with brunch at one of the restaurants, then move to a more lively bar as game time approaches. The outdoor plaza is a popular gathering spot, with live music and interactive games. The venue also hosts special events throughout the season, such as player appearances and autograph signings.     McGillin's Olde Ale House

    Step back in time at McGillin's Olde Ale House, Philadelphia's oldest continuously operating tavern. This historic spot has been serving up cold beers and good times since 1860. While it's not exclusively an Eagles bar, the atmosphere is always festive during games, and the history of the place adds a unique charm. Plus, McGillin's is known for its friendly service and reasonable prices, making it a great option for a casual game-day outing. The walls are adorned with memorabilia from throughout the bar's history, creating a cozy and nostalgic atmosphere.
